HC Deb 11 November 1980 vol 992 c101W
Mr. Wrigglesworth

asked the Secretary of State for the Environment when he expects to make an announcement about the future of the Department of Transport and Department of the Environment offices in Newcastle; and how many jobs will be lost in Newcastle if the proposals contained in the Rayner proposals are implemented.

Mr. Heseltine

My right hon. Friend the Minister of Transport and I hope to be in a position to make an announcement about the future of all our joint regional offices before the end of this year. The study officer's report recommends a reduction of some 26 jobs in Newcastle, mainly because of the transfer of work concerning Cumbria to the North-West regional office.
